Auth is HTTP Basic over `base64(email:token)` — your **email address**, never a password (passwords are deprecated for API use). Cloud has no Personal Access Tokens; Bearer PATs are Data Center only. Tokens now expire after at most one year. `--help` and `--dry-run` work without credentials.

## Known Gotchas
- **Search endpoint duality** — this CLI uses the classic `/rest/api/3/search` with offset pagination (`startAt`, `maxResults`, `total`). Atlassian's enhanced `/rest/api/3/search/jql` replaces it with an opaque `nextPageToken` (+ `isLast`), no `startAt`, no `total`, ids-only default fields, and it rejects unbounded JQL (`order by key desc` alone → 400). The classic endpoint is deprecated ("currently being removed", announced Oct 2024, removal promised after May 1 2025), so expect forced migration; mixing the two pagination models is the classic source of infinite-page-one loops.
- **Pagination caps** — legacy pages default to `maxResults=50`; `total` can shrink between pages, so always tolerate empty pages instead of trusting a stale total.
- **Transitions need GET first** — transition IDs (`"31"`, `"711"`) belong to one workflow/status; asking for an invalid one returns an *empty list*, not an error. Done-style screens frequently require `resolution`; missing required fields come back as `400` with `"errors": {"resolution": "..."}` naming them.
- **ADF everywhere** — descriptions, comments, and environment fields take ADF JSON objects in v3 payloads; bare strings are rejected.
- **Authentication** uses HTTP Basic with email + API token. CAPTCHA lockouts (repeated bad logins) block REST auth entirely; symptom header: `X-Seraph-LoginReason: AUTHENTICATION_DENIED`. Fix in the browser, not by retrying.
- **Rate limits** return 429 with `Retry-After` and `RateLimit-Reason` headers; the CLI surfaces both but does not auto-retry. Writes also cap at ~20/2s per issue.
- **Project keys are case-sensitive** in some contexts, though the API generally accepts either case.
- **accountId, not username** — user fields accept Atlassian account IDs (GDPR migration); usernames were removed from the API.
### JQL gotchas
- **`!=` excludes empty values** — `assignee != currentUser()` silently drops unassigned issues. Write `(assignee != currentUser() OR assignee IS EMPTY)`.
- **AND binds tighter than OR** — `A OR B AND C` parses as `A OR (B AND C)`. Always parenthesize OR groups; without parentheses evaluation is left-to-right.
- **No leading wildcards** — `summary ~ "*bug"` forces a full scan; put wildcards after the first characters.
- **Filter by project first** — the biggest performance lever on large instances (official optimization guidance).
- **History operators have a field whitelist** — `WAS`/`CHANGED` work only on Assignee, Fix Version, Priority, Reporter, Resolution, Status, and silently return nothing on fields without history tracking.
- **Relative dates are case-sensitive** — `-1m` is minutes, `-1M` is months; day-grain expressions evaluate in each user's timezone.
- **JQL has no aggregation** — no COUNT/SUM; use `jira count` (approximate-count endpoint) or dashboard gadgets.

## Limitations
- Targets Jira **Cloud** REST v3; Data Center sites authenticate differently (Bearer PAT) and expose older API surfaces
- The classic search endpoint this CLI uses is deprecated upstream; expect eventual forced migration to `/search/jql` token paging
- Rich-text creation beyond plain paragraphs requires hand-built ADF JSON
- No auto-retry on 429; loops over many writes should sleep between calls
